Everything you need to know to make an Arduino-based oceanography research platform from scratch with no experience and basic tools! There are multiple system builds depending on science mission:

  1. Traditional CTD (salinity, temperature) with a 1.5in and 2.0in PVC or 2.0in steel pipe version (top right, both bottom)

  2. Temperature logger (long-term temperature only monitoring, no pressure sensor, top right)

  3. Bottom Pressure Recorder (BPR, pressure only for wave/tide measuring, middle right)

  4. Surface float (salinity, temperature, optional GNSS/location)
